titleOfInvention | Perfluoro group-containing compound emulsion |
abstract | P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ide an emulsion having a perfluoro group-containing compound having improved storage stability even when a fluorine-containing compound is used as an emulsifier for a perfluoropolyether oil or a perfluorocarbon compound. SOLUTION: A perfluoro group-containing compound emulsion in which a perfluoropolyether oil or a perfluorocarbon compound is dispersed and emulsified in a water-soluble organic solvent and a fluorine-based organic solvent in the presence of a fluorine-containing emulsifier. This perfluoro group-containing compound emulsion is excellent in storage stability, for example, at 40 ° C. after 1 month or 6 months, and its average particle size hardly changes.
